解决Shadowsocks SSL连接错误的全面指南

在当今互联网环境中,Shadowsocks已成为用户规避审查和保护隐私的重要工具。然而,用户在使用Shadowsocks时可能会遇到各种问题,其中最常见的就是SSL连接错误。本文将详细讨论导致Shadowsocks SSL连接错误的原因,以及如何有效解决这些问题。

什么是Shadowsocks?

Shadowsocks是一种代理工具,它利用SOCKS5协议来转发网络流量,从而帮助用户实现翻墙。与传统的VPN相比,Shadowsocks在连接速度和隐私保护方面有着显著的优势。它主要通过使用加密技术来保护数据传输的安全性,尤其是SSL加密技术。

Shadowsocks SSL连接错误的常见原因

SSL连接错误可能由多种原因引起,以下是一些主要因素:

  • 服务器问题:如果Shadowsocks服务器出现故障或不在线,用户将无法建立SSL连接。
  • 网络不稳定:不稳定的网络连接会导致SSL握手失败,进而产生连接错误。
  • 防火墙设置:某些地区的防火墙可能会阻止SSL连接,影响Shadowsocks的正常使用。
  • 配置错误:用户在配置Shadowsocks时可能输入错误的信息,如IP地址、端口号等,导致SSL连接无法建立。
  • SSL证书过期:如果使用的SSL证书过期,可能会引发连接错误。

如何解决Shadowsocks SSL连接错误?

1. 检查服务器状态

  • 确认Shadowsocks服务器是否在线,可以通过使用ping命令检查服务器的响应。
  • 如果服务器出现故障,尝试切换到其他可用的服务器。

2. 确保网络连接稳定

  • 尝试重启路由器或更换网络连接,如使用移动数据或其他Wi-Fi网络。
  • 使用网络测试工具来检查当前的网络速度和稳定性。

3. 检查防火墙设置

  • 检查防火墙或安全软件的设置,确保Shadowsocks程序被允许访问网络。
  • 在防火墙中添加Shadowsocks的例外规则,允许其通过。

4. 检查配置文件

  • 仔细检查Shadowsocks的配置文件,确保所有信息输入正确,包括服务器地址、端口和加密方式。
  • 如果可能,使用自动配置脚本来生成配置文件。

5. 更新SSL证书

  • 定期检查SSL证书的有效性,确保其在有效期内。如果过期,联系服务器提供商更新证书。

常见问题解答(FAQ)

Q1: 什么是Shadowsocks SSL连接错误?

A: Shadowsocks SSL连接错误是指在使用Shadowsocks代理时,由于SSL握手失败或连接不稳定,导致无法成功建立连接。

Q2: 如何知道我的Shadowsocks配置是否正确?

A: 你可以通过检查配置文件中的服务器地址、端口号和加密方式是否与服务器提供商提供的信息一致来判断。使用ping命令测试服务器是否可达也能提供帮助。

Q3: SSL连接错误通常会影响哪些功能?

A: SSL连接错误会导致无法访问被限制的网站、无法加载网页内容以及断开其他网络服务的连接。

Q4: 是否可以使用其他协议代替SSL?

A: Shadowsocks支持多种加密方式,包括AEAD、ChaCha20等。如果SSL连接出现问题,可以尝试更换为其他加密方式。

Q5: 如何选择可靠的Shadowsocks服务器?

A: 选择服务器时应考虑服务器的稳定性、带宽和延迟,推荐使用知名的Shadowsocks服务提供商,并查看用户评价和反馈。

结论

Shadowsocks是一款功能强大的代理工具,但在使用过程中可能会遇到SSL连接错误。通过以上提到的方法,可以有效地诊断和解决这些问题,从而提升使用体验。如果你仍然遇到问题,建议咨询专业的技术支持。希望本文能为你提供有用的帮助,祝你在网络世界中畅通无阻!

正文完